> On 10/25/06, Trey Thompson <treythompson at gmail.com> wrote:
> > I started getting this yesterday after being out of town for 4 days:
> > [root at mythtvbe conf]# yum install perl-Video-DVDRip
> > Loading "installonlyn" plugin
> > Setting up Install Process
> > Setting up repositories
> > atrpms [1/5]
> > atrpms 100% |=========================| 951 B 00:00
> > core [2/5]
> > Cannot find a valid baseurl for repo: core
> > Error: Cannot find a valid baseurl for repo: core
> >
> > So, I searched the list, and google. I disabled some of the repos so
> > that I could get something else from atrpms.net, and that appeared to
> > have worked fine. But, I re-enabled everything, and I still get the
> > same error above.
> >
> > I checked the file datestamps for the repos before I made any changes,
> > and they were the original configs from the install a few months ago.
> > _______________________________________________
>
> My understanding is that the official Fedora servers are currently
> overwhelmed with the release of FC6.
> Yum is unable to download the mirror list.
>
> Edit /etc/yum.repos.d/fedora-core.repo
> Uncomment the line in front of "baseurl".
>
> See if that works for you.
>
> Dave
